How to care

How often do I water my Hydrangea?

The Hydrangea paniculata is crazy about moist soil. So water regularly! Especially during warm periods. Hydrangeas prefer to get watered a few times a week rather than a little bit every day. Always pour water on the soil and not on the flower. Hot summer days? Water them in the morning or in the evening. At those moments, the plant is at ‘rest’ and absorbs water better.

Does my Hydrangea withstand severe winters?

Absolutely. Our cultivars withstand extreme temperatures. Coping with temperatures falling to -30º. Living Creations Hydrangeas are among the most winter-hardy ones. They grow all over the world and even survive the Siberian winters.

What’s best: growing Hydrangeas in pots or in the ground?

In their natural habitat, Hydrangeas grow in the ground, of course. Their roots can develop freely that way. But don’t worry if you prefer Hydrangeas in containers. Nowadays, we can mimic ideal conditions by giving potted plants the right fertilisers and plenty of water. When choosing a pot, pay attention to the size, it is important that the hydrangea gets enough space.

Which container fits my Hydrangea best?

The plastic Living Creations pot your Hydrangea comes in is a useful tool here. The container should be a little wider than the pot. That will ensure enough loose soil fits around the sides so that the roots can grow and develop. Make sure the new container is 2 to 5 cm higher than the plastic pot as the roots should not emerge above the soil.

How deep should I plant them?

The containers they come in are a useful indicator. Remove a Hydrangea from the pot and place the pot next to the desired spot. Dig a hole that is just a little wider and 2 to 5 cm deeper than the pot. That way, the roots won’t emerge above the ground and there will be enough loose soil all around the plant for the roots to stretch out and develop.

Should I grow my Hydrangea in the sun or shade?

Hydrangeas prefer a sunny or semi-shady spot. That’s how they look the best. Your Hydrangea will flourish in these conditions and the flowers will colour beautifully. Hydrangeas can be placed in the shade but be aware that they will tend to grow towards the light. But be aware that they will tend to grow towards the light. This leads to long branches instead of the compact growth and flowering most people prefer.
